Chief Executive Officer And Managing DirectorBlack Rock Mining Ltd Jan 2017 - PresentAuBlack Rock Mining is an Australian graphite developer. With Resreves of 70mt @ 8.5% TGC, Black Rock Mining’s Mahenge Project in Tanzania, is ranked second globally. The Mahenge development model is reflective of the new Tanzanian legislative environment and is a high grade concentrate only business model, developed over three stages as a self-funding boot strap model. Organisational design is a Tanzanian centric operating model, with an offshore governance centre. Role scope:• Build and lead an organisation capable of developing the Mahenge asset • Develop the mine and business in a sustainable manner consistent with the Equator principals• Engage with government and agencies to secure operating licences and permits• Identify and secure funding• Engage with capital and equity markets to ensure project value is maximised Major Achievements:• Deliver Pre-Feasibility Study increasing NPV from $170m USD to $905m USD after tax, inclusive of free carried interest• Commence Definitive Feasibility Study with leading industry engineering house• Develop operating model consistent with revised Tanzanian legislation• Restructured organisation to align with development model -

General Manager Technical ServicesSt Barbara Limited Nov 2011 - Jul 2015Perth, Western Australia, AuSt Barbara (SBM) is a mid-tier Australian gold producer and explorer. Annual production ranges from 350 Koz to 400 Koz, with a market cap of $ AUD1.4 b. Operations include the 1 mtpa underground Gwalia Deeps mine in Leonora, Western Australia and the 3.6 mtpa, Simberi open pit in Papua New Guinea. - Resource and Reserve governance, incl Reserve CP - Improved estimation methodology to improve Reserve estimation while reducing infill drill density - Delivery and oversight of end to end planning process - Province Plan, LoM, Budget to daily - Delivered revised double lift stoping method increasing ore delivery and reducing development - Revised mine wide geotechnical model to permit LHOS at 1500m depth - Delivered worlds’ fist application of absorption cooling for mines, on spec, on time and on budget - Part of team recovering failed Simberi expansion -
Manager Strategic Mine PlanningBhp Billiton Feb 2006 - Nov 2011Melbourne, Victoria, AuWith annual production of 100 kt of Nickel, BHP Billiton Nickel West is the third largest vertically integrated Ni sulphide producer in the world. NiWest operated two mines, the large 55 mtpa Mt Keith open pit and 1.8 mtpa Leinster sub level cave. Additional concentrate is sourced from third parties. - Resource and Reserve governance, incl Reserve CP, and internal auditor for other BHPB properties - Delivered major project studies incl Revised Stage H Cut Back for Mt Keith, and Leinster Deeps SLC. - Used synthetic rock mass modelling to safely steepen pit wall by an average of 3 degrees - Used conditional simulation to better estimate and manage talc contamination in ore delivery -
